Israel to reopen Gaza’s Rafah crossing after search for captive’s body ends
Published On 26 Jan 202626 Jan 2026
- Hamas’s military wing has given “all the details” to truce mediators on the possible location of the last captive’s body to be returned to Israel under the US-brokered ceasefire.
- The Israeli military says it launched a “targeted operation” in northern Gaza “to exhaust all of the intelligence” and retrieve the remains of police officer Ran Gvili.
